1700010I14Rik Gene Summary [Mouse]

Is expressed in ileum; male reproductive gland or organ; and midbrain. Orthologous to human C6orf118 (chromosome 6 open reading frame 118). [provided by Alliance of Genome Resources, Jul 2025]
